🎤When you are writing an emotional, sad or romantic scene, how do you get into the mood?
There are 2 ways for me to get into 'the mood' as you define it; I pretend to be the protagonist of my story and when it does not work, I listen to the songs of the same category, you mentioned, like a romantic song, for a romantic scene, a sad song for a sad scene and that's that!

🎤What advice would you give a new writer, someone just starting out?
I would just say if you want to write something, just do it! Don't listen to people that want to demotivate you. If you personally think that you are not capable of doing it, but you still want to, that's okay! Not everything can be perfect at the first try! It would take some time, like the editing of the grammatical errors and removing some touché scenes from your book, if there are any, but trust me it would be worth it at the end of the day! And yeah not all people will read your book but remember always do things for your own self not for others. Don't please people that don't want to be pleased! If publishing your own work gives you the satisfaction then let it be! Do it for your own sake.
